5 votos

¿Cómo fijar el rendimiento del servidor muy lento en OS X Lion?

Tengo un 2008 Mac Pro (MacPro3.1 -- doble de 3 GHz quad-core Xeon, memoria de 6GB) Lion (10.7.3) que estoy usando para un servidor, para que una empresa (archivos, de impresión, medios de comunicación, etc.) así como un servidor de desarrollo para un bonito estándar de PHP de la pila. De vez en cuando, pero la mayoría del tiempo, otras máquinas tomar un tiempo MUY largo para llegar a la máquina a través de la red -- diez segundos para mostrar un trivial página html, por ejemplo. El problema parece ser uno de llegar a la máquina -- si puedo ver el servidor apache registros después de hacer un pedido, voy a ver inicialmente nada sucede, y luego una ráfaga de actividad una vez (supongo que aquí) la petición llega al servidor y se maneja. Pero hay otros momentos en los que el rendimiento es bueno.

Algunos detalles:

  • Yo sobre todo ver esto con acceso a la web, pero yo a veces también te largas demoras en la apertura de un uso Compartido de Pantalla o de una conexión ssh a la máquina. Por lo tanto yo no creo que sea un Apache problema. Reiniciar Apache también no tiene ningún efecto.
  • Si el problema que está sucediendo y me golpeó el mismo sitio web de la Mac Pro, el rendimiento es aceptable. Esto me hace mirar hacia la red.
  • Tengo otro servidor -- un cuadro de linux -- en la misma red, y no tiene estos problemas. Así que, a menos que haya algo raro sobre el nombre de dominio, no parece que sea un problema con mi servicio de internet.
  • La máquina no suele ser bajo una carga significativa -- superior los informes de la carga promedio de alrededor .3, y mis intentos de poner encima de la carga (uso compartido de pantalla, reproducción de vídeos, etc.) no parecen tener mucho impacto.
  • Yo lo he desactivado IPv6 en el panel de control de Red.
  • No hay nada de obvio (para mí, de todos modos) el interés en los archivos de registro.

Sé que no es mucho para ir por el, pero ¿alguien por ahí tiene algún conocimiento? Esto está empezando a ser un problema real. Gracias!

1voto

Philzen Puntos 116

Si es que no responde a los pings (significado de ping está volviendo a la "Solicitud de tiempo de espera"), entonces el problema no es, definitivamente, DNS o nada en el nivel de aplicación. Veo dos posibilidades:

  • Falla de Hardware: un conmutador o interfaz de red está fallando. Ya que tienes otro trabajo de la máquina (presumiblemente) en el mismo interruptor, tal vez su puerto ethernet o cable ethernet a tener problemas. Pruebe con un cable diferente. Intenta configurar de otra interfaz (tal vez a través de WiFi, o mejor aún a través de ethernet USB dongle) sólo lo puede hacer ping a ver si se va hacia abajo.

  • Configuración de jitter: algo puede ser la causa de su configuración de red para cambiar de forma inesperada, similar a si se ha cambiado la Ubicación de Red. Revise su sistema.y registro de la consola.registro. Ver lo que está sucediendo alrededor de los tiempos de estas cortes.

No he visto OS X de repente cambiar su configuración de red desde el 10,5 Servidor, por lo que fallo de hardware, parece más probable. Pero definitivamente se verá en su sistema.y registro de la consola.registro.

0voto

John S Perayil Puntos 444

Que estoy apostando que usas el nombre del equipo y según Bonjour/mDNS para resolución de nombres, que casi siempre es último recurso de la máquina (por lo tanto la espera para todos los otros medios posibles de resolución para dar para arriba).

Si este es el caso, la solución es usar algo confiable, como direcciones de DNS correcta, IP, o incluso los archivos hosts (aunque esto se debe evitar también).

0voto

Nate Puntos 220

El hecho de que usted está viendo las redirecciones desde el router me sugiere que usted tiene algún tipo de problema de enrutamiento. Se que sucede cuando usted ping desde otra pc en la misma subred? Si es así, el router no debe estar involucrado en todas (y la redirección es, básicamente, su forma de decir, "¿por qué usted envíe esto a mí?"). La situación que me gustaría esperar a causar este tipo de cosas es cuando los equipos (y/o router) no están de acuerdo en lo de la máscara de subred es. Hace todo lo que está de acuerdo en lo de la red rango de direcciones?

Si ese no es el caso, puede ayudar si usted ha clarificado cómo su red, configurar, y sobre todo, cómo los routers entre el Mac y el equipo que está haciendo ping desde.

AppleAyuda.com

AppleAyuda es una comunidad de usuarios de los productos de Apple en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X